Meanings
verb
- 1.To mix together, to mix up; to confuse.
- 2.To mash slightly for use in a cocktail.
- 3.To dabble in mud.
- 4.To make turbid or muddy.
- 5.To think and act in a confused, aimless way.
noun
- 1.The act of one who muddles; confusion; disorderly progress.
